Recertification Process

RENEWAL

Certifications must be renewed every 3 years to be considered Active Status. ( Non renewals will be put on the INACTIVE list  for only 12 months at which they must re-active or Lapse) Inactive status does not give permission to use meditation specialist credentials nor to receive any discounts on products or trainings.

Renewal applications are due at least 1 month before your certification expiration date.

Meditation Specialist I (MSI-BC) indicates 300 hr. training course or equivalent;  plus, satisfactory completion of written exam and practical exam . Renewal of certification consists of 150 hours over a period of 3 years for renewal  Renewal cost: $ 200

Clinical Meditation Specialist II (CMSII-BC) indicates initial 300 hrs. training (level 1) or equivalent,  plus an additional 240 hrs. of clinical contact, teaching and practice over a period of 3 years.  Renewal cost:  $ 225

Advanced Practice Meditation Specialist  III (APMSIII-BC) indicates  Advanced Practice 500 hrs of clinical practice and teaching contact beyond level II, over a period of 3 years. Renewal cost:  $250

 RE-CERTIFICATION REQUIRES that the Meditation Specialist Adhere to the Code of Ethics as well as

    •Continue to be in good standing in their work environment;

    •Be in active practice in Meditation; and

    •Provide documentation of active learning through continuing education as described below.

    Successful completion of  specified contact hours (see above for level of certification)  of Continuing Education in Alternative and Complementary medicine and/or Meditation within the three years period preceding the date of expiration of the certification period.   At least twenty percent (40%) of the contact hours must directly address Evidence - based meditation practices.  The remaining contact hours can be related to alternative and complementary methods of practice; studies that facilitate self-care and growth; and transformation within a holistic context. Alternative options for Continuing Education Units can be considered by the Board.

   The contact hours must be approved by a licensing board, credentialing body, educational institution or other qualified individual or organization.  Appropriate documentation of continued education (such as certificates of completion) must be submitted with application for Recertification.

    Re-certification Documentation

    Re-certification requires submission of several documents no later than 60 days prior to certification expiration. These include:

    1)    Re-certification Application form,  Document

    2)    CE documentation record form  Document

    3)    Recertification fee (see above for fee applicable to level of renewal certification requested)

 

    NMSCB has Gone Green. Please download Re-certification documents by clicking the documents tab. Re-certification packets will be sent by e- mail only upon request.   

   Failure to submit a complete packet within 60 days prior to Certification Expiration Date results in a late fee of $35.00 . Individuals submitting a Re-certification Packet within 90 days after expiration of their Certification are required to pay a late fee of $100.00.

   Inactive participants are required to pay an additional $25 in addition to renewal fees and criteria to become active.

    Packets submitted more than 90 days post certification expiration are not accepted.  They are put into inactive status and are required to sit for board certification again if inactive status exceeds one year.  Appeals for exceptions require NMS Board review and will be considered only once in the Certificates lifetime.
